German fingering is used for soprano recorders in elementary school, and Baroque fingering is used for alto recorders in junior high school. The difference is in the fingering for "F" and "F#". Depending on the region, some areas use Baroque fingering even for soprano recorders. Please be sure to check with your school to see if you can use the fingering system and skeleton type.
